Abstract
- The secular equation of medium coating were obtained by considering the particularity of THz, which had some reference value in designing of THz waveguides. The attenuation of medium coating metal hallow waveguides were theoretically calculated, the conclusion is that the power loss is less than the metal waveguides. Also we obtained the mode characters and attenuation in metal waveguides, and we noted that there exists an absorption peak. And we studied the affection of shape and size on propagation and got some useful conclusion. The split rectangular waveguide (SRW) is suitable for THz transmission which is confirmed by experiment. Our secular equation can be considered to be a theoretically discussion on it.
